Mix / Pan / Flip / Done:
No banana. No blender. No drama.
What You Need:
3 to 4 tablespoons of applesauce
2 to 3 tablespoons of flour (oat, rice, or regular)
1 tablespoon of plant-based yogurt or milk
Optional: cinnamon or vanilla
How It Works:
Mix everything together until you get a smooth batter.
Pour into a hot pan.
Cook on one side, then flip.
Done.
Why It Works:
This recipe follows your system:
Fiber+ from applesauce and flour
Carbs for quick energy
Optional protein depending on your yogurt choice
Comfort and satisfaction without complexity
Make It Yours:
You can adjust depending on your energy and what you have:
Add peanut butter for more satisfaction
Swap applesauce with another fruit purée (cherry,apricot…)
Use different flours depending on what’s available
